You can turn off this in oculus debug tool. More info here - https://developer.oculus.com/documentation/pcsdk/latest/concepts/dg-debug-tool/ .

But considering the fact that ASW can help in other games I would recommend you to download oculus tray tool in which you can create profiles for different games ---> https://forums.oculusvr.com/communi...ng-profiles-hmd-disconnect-fixes-hopefully/p1


OMG that was so easy to fix with the Tray Tool!!!! Thanks Disabling AWS fixed it for me right away

Symptoms : Stations and Planets was introducing some major graphical problems only when turning my head. It gave the sense of having 2 images at the same time on my screen.
